Understanding the Driving License Process
The procedure of acquiring a driving license varies by country and in some cases even by state or province. Nevertheless, many areas follow a comparable structure. Here's a basic overview of the actions involved:
Eligibility Check
Age Requirements: The minimum age for getting a learner's license or provisional license differs. In the United States, for instance, it is typically 15 or 16 years of ages, while in the United Kingdom, it is 17.Residency: You need to be a resident of the state or country where you are looking for a license.Recognition: You will require to offer valid recognition, such as a passport, birth certificate, or social security card.
Learner's Permit
Composed Test: Before you can get a learner's permit, you need to pass a written test that covers traffic laws, road signs, and safe driving practices.Application: Fill out the application and pay the needed fee.Monitored Driving: With a learner's authorization, you can practice driving under the supervision of a certified adult.
Motorist's Education and Training
Driver's Education Course: Many regions need conclusion of a chauffeur's education course, which can be taken online or in individual.Behind-the-Wheel Training: Practical driving lessons are important to get the essential skills and self-confidence.
Provisionary or kupić prawo jazdy B Intermediate License
Requirements: After holding a learner's permit for a specified duration (usually 6 months to a year), you can obtain a provisionary license.Driving Test: You should pass a road test, which consists of demonstrating your ability to drive securely and follow traffic laws.Restrictions: Provisional licenses often include constraints, such as a curfew or a limitation on the variety of travelers.
Complete Driver's License

Q: How long does it take to get a driving license?
A: The time it requires to obtain a driving license can differ depending upon your place and the particular requirements. Typically, it can take anywhere from a couple of months to a year, including the time spent holding a student's permit and preparing for the roadway test.
Q: Can I get a driving license without a student's license?
A: In many regions, a learner's permit is a required action before obtaining a full chauffeur's license. It enables you to practice driving under guidance and get ready for the roadway test.
Q: What is the minimum age to get a learner's authorization?
A: The minimum age for a student's permit differs by region. In the United States, it is generally 15 or 16 years of ages, while in the United Kingdom, it is 17.
Q: Do I need to take a driver's education course?
A: Many areas need completion of a driver's education course. This course covers vital driving skills and knowledge, helping you end up being a much safer and more confident motorist.
Q: What should I do if I fail the roadway test?
A: If you fail the roadway test, don't be prevented. Recognize the areas where you need improvement and practice those skills. You can normally retake the test after a given period, which varies by region.
Q: Can I use a pal or relative as a driving instructor?
A: While you can practice driving with a certified adult, it is typically helpful to take official driving lessons from a certified instructor. They can provide professional assistance and help you establish excellent driving routines.
